Yesterday evening (3rd March) we commenced the second of our Lent Groups: Rosary 101.
We talked all about the Rosary, where it came from, about prayers beads in general, the 15 promises, Jesus, Mary, the Gospel, devotions, S. Dominic, Portugal, World War 1 – and so much more! The group even practiced a couple of decades and learnt how to add personal intentions.
Pictured above is the 3rd edition of the Rosary booklet we use; it contains all of the prayers, Gospel readings, plus some interesting information about the Rosary. You don’t even need Rosary beads to use it, everything you need is in the booklet.
